Understanding MTF and Its Purpose
Margin Trading Facility (MTF) is a mechanism provided by brokers that allows investors to purchase securities by borrowing funds against their existing portfolio. This facility helps traders enhance their market exposure without investing additional capital upfront. The primary goal of MTF is to increase liquidity and provide traders with leverage, enabling them to capitalize on market opportunities. However, the use of leverage also involves higher risk, which is why only certain scrips approved by the NSE can be traded under this facility.
Key Features of MTF
- Leverage Traders can increase their market exposure by borrowing funds against owned securities.
- Eligibility Only approved scrips listed on the MTF approved scrip list can be traded under this facility.
- Margin Requirement Brokers define the minimum margin that a trader must maintain, which varies depending on the scrip’s volatility and liquidity.
- Risk Management NSE and brokers impose limits and guidelines to minimize default and market risk.
By understanding these features, investors can effectively utilize MTF while ensuring that risk exposure remains within manageable levels.
MTF Approved Scrip List on NSE
The MTF approved scrip list on NSE is a comprehensive inventory of securities eligible for margin trading. This list is maintained and periodically updated by brokers in accordance with NSE guidelines. The selection criteria for inclusion in the list are based on factors such as market capitalization, liquidity, volatility, and past trading history. The list ensures that only highly liquid and less risky securities are available for leveraged trading, reducing the chances of defaults and price manipulation.
Criteria for Scrip Approval
- Liquidity Only stocks with high trading volume are included to ensure easy entry and exit for traders.
- Market Capitalization Large-cap and mid-cap stocks are typically preferred due to their relative stability.
- Volatility Stocks with controlled volatility are prioritized to reduce the risk of margin calls.
- Past Performance Consistent trading history and absence of regulatory issues are considered.
The criteria ensure that traders have access to stable securities that are suitable for leveraged trading under the MTF facility.
How to Use the MTF Approved Scrip List
Investors can use the MTF approved scrip list to make informed trading decisions. The list serves as a guide for which stocks can be purchased using borrowed funds, helping traders plan their portfolio and margin utilization. Brokers usually provide access to the updated list, which includes details such as scrip codes, margin requirements, maximum leverage allowed, and other risk parameters.
Steps to Access and Utilize the List
- Obtain the latest MTF approved scrip list from your broker or the NSE website.
- Check the scrip codes and margin requirements for the securities you intend to trade.
- Evaluate your portfolio and determine the available collateral for borrowing.
- Place MTF orders with your broker according to the approved limits.
- Monitor your positions regularly to avoid margin calls and manage risk.
Using the list responsibly helps traders leverage opportunities while maintaining financial discipline and minimizing potential losses.

Risks Associated with MTF Trading
While MTF provides opportunities for higher gains, it also carries significant risks. Investors need to understand the potential downsides and prepare for market volatility. The NSE-approved scrip list mitigates some risk by restricting leverage to eligible, liquid securities, but traders must still exercise caution.
Major Risks
- Margin Calls If the value of the purchased securities declines, brokers may require additional funds to maintain positions.
- Leverage Risk Borrowed funds can amplify both gains and losses, increasing potential financial exposure.
- Market Volatility Sudden market movements can result in significant losses if positions are not monitored carefully.
- Regulatory Risk Changes in NSE guidelines or broker policies can impact the availability of certain scrips for MTF trading.
Awareness of these risks and prudent risk management strategies are essential for traders using MTF facilities.
